A fine Japanese Taishō period (1912–1924) silver bonbonnière box featuring beautifully engraved floral and Imperial crane decorations. The interior is adorned with applied 24K gold family mon (crests). Please see the photographs.
For reference, this example is illustrated in the catalog of the Japanese Silver Bonbonnière.
The box has an elegant oval form and bears the artist's signature, silver hallmarks, and additional inscriptions.
Condition: Excellent original condition with no losses, damage, repairs, or restorations.
